Ode grin there's nothing to verify. All Agrictech companies in Nigeria are registered as Enterprise and Limited Liability Companies. What that means is that majority are one man businesses, with no board of directors, no independent or non-executive directors, no external auditing and in fact, should anyone of them scam you, you are on your own! They're under no REGULATION, asides the MORALLY binding contractual obligation to pay you.

Let me also shock you with this fact that no insurance firm will insure a company or an investment instrument that promises to pay you interest for life. grin They're not f00ls like you grin How will they guarantee you constant interest for as long as you live when even the companies can't boast of surviving the next decade or jubilee. Even bonds have timelines with the highest being 20 or 30 years.
